Description

New energy battery production line protection cover module
Technical Field
The application relates to the technical field of new energy batteries, in particular to a protective cover module for a new energy battery production line.
Background
The key technology that new energy automobile developed is new energy battery module, and these new energy battery modules provide power supply for new energy automobile, and among the current battery module, behind the top of module board increased insulating safety cover, only adopted the screw to lock fixedly between module board and the safety cover through several fixed points in periphery, and the safety cover mid portion is not supported, very easily can have the safety cover to take place to rock the risk of beating new energy battery in the use.

Detailed Description
The present application is described in further detail below in conjunction with figures 1-4.
The embodiment of the application discloses a new energy battery production line protection cover module, refer to fig. 1, fig. 2, fig. 3 and fig. 4, including module board 1 and module protection cover 2, module protection cover 2 lays on the top of module board 1, the both ends of module protection cover 2 are contradicted with two inside walls of module board 1 respectively, module board 1 can be used to support new energy battery, and module protection cover 2 can be used to protect the new energy battery who installs in module board 1, one side fixed mounting of module board 1 has a plurality of wiring port, with new energy battery and wiring port linear connection, and with the consumer of peripheral hardware and wiring port linear connection, then can make new energy battery give the consumer power supply of peripheral hardware, the both ends of module protection cover 2 both sides all are provided with the fixed subassembly 3 that are used for carrying out the fixation between module protection cover 2 and the module board 1, so can not make module board 1 and module protection cover 2 can break away from the contact easily, the both ends at the top of module board 1 all fixedly connected with first bracing piece 41, the top and the bottom of two first bracing pieces 41 wherein both sides of two first bracing pieces 41 are all fixedly connected with second bracing pieces 42, the top and bottom of two first bracing pieces 42 of two sides of two first and first module protection cover 41 are equipped with the bracing pieces 43 and two inside the support grooves 43 are equipped with the bracing pieces at the inside the two side of first and second module 41 respectively, wherein the top 43 and two top pieces are equipped with the inside the bracing pieces 43 respectively, one side of the other two second support rods 42 and one side of the other first support rod 41 are attached to the other inner side wall of the module protection cover 2, and the top end face of the third support rod 43 is attached to the inner top wall of the module protection cover 2, so that the function of supporting the module protection cover 2 in real time can be exerted, the module protection cover 2 is prevented from shaking and hitting the new energy battery pack, and the new energy battery pack is better protected.
Referring to fig. 1, 2 and 3, the fixing component 3 is composed of a clamping rod 31 and a screw 32, two ends of the clamping rod 31 respectively movably penetrate through two corners of one side of the module protection cover 2, two ends of the clamping rod 31 are movably inserted into the bottom end of the module board 1, so that the module protection cover 2 and the module board 1 can be fixed, the screw 32 is threaded through one side of the module protection cover 2, the screw 32 is in threaded connection with the module board 1, and the fixing component 3 is prevented from being separated from the module board 1 and the module protection cover 2.
Referring to fig. 1, 2 and 3, a plurality of heat dissipation holes 6 are formed in the back side and the front side of the module protection cover 2, the plurality of heat dissipation holes 6 are distributed in a matrix shape, and the plurality of heat dissipation holes 6 are convenient for timely dissipating heat generated when the new energy battery pack in the module board 1 works.
Referring to fig. 1 and 2, the bottom of the module board 1 is provided with four rubber feet 5, the four rubber feet 5 are respectively adhered to four corners of the bottom end of the module board 1, and the four rubber feet 5 can play a supporting role on the module board 1.
The implementation principle of the protective cover module of the new energy battery production line provided by the embodiment of the application is as follows: when the novel energy battery pack is used, the novel energy battery pack is installed in the module board 1, the novel energy battery pack is linearly connected with the wiring port, then the module protection cover 2 is installed on the module board 1 and sleeved with the novel energy battery pack, one side of two second support rods 42 and one side of one first support rod 41 are attached to one inner side wall of the module protection cover 2, one side of the other two second support rods 42 and one side of the other first support rod 41 are attached to the other inner side wall of the module protection cover 2, the top end face of the third support rod 43 is attached to the inner top wall of the module protection cover 2, the function of supporting the module protection cover 2 in real time can be exerted, the module protection cover 2 is prevented from shaking to the novel energy battery pack, the novel energy battery pack is protected better, and finally four clamping rods 31 penetrate the module protection cover 2 and are movably connected with the module board 1, and four screws 32 penetrate the module protection cover 2 and are connected with the module protection cover 1 in a threaded mode, and fixing between the module protection cover 2 and the module protection cover 1 can be completed.
